Web17 Feb 2024 · Camera Settings: Aperture, Shutter Speed, ISO…and Bracket! 1. DO NOT USE A FLASH. When the sun is out, the flash is useless. When the sun is obscured and all is dark, … WebThe best strategy is to bracket widely during totality to shoot a large range of exposures. I typically shoot at ISO 200, f/9 and will use shutter speeds ranging from 1/1000 down to 1 or more seconds. Web21 Oct 2024 · Set the aperture to between f/5.6 and f/8. With your camera and long lens on a tripod, use your LCD screen on ‘live view’ to find the eclipsed Sun and then auto-focus on the edge of the Moon.
